What's in the feed now

Tax year 2022 — spent $414,370 more than it took in. Revenue $3,932,822 · expenses $4,347,192 · reserve months 5.1
Tax year 2021 — took in $1,098,874 more than it spent. Revenue $4,377,840 · expenses $3,278,966 · reserve months 8.3
Tax year 2020 — spent $140,367 more than it took in. Revenue $2,505,566 · expenses $2,645,933 · reserve months 5.3
Tax year 2019 — took in $203,939 more than it spent. Revenue $2,573,058 · expenses $2,369,119 · reserve months 6.6
Tax year 2018 — took in $419,118 more than it spent. Revenue $2,844,753 · expenses $2,425,635 · reserve months 5.3
Tax year 2017 — took in $154,265 more than it spent. Revenue $1,684,910 · expenses $1,530,645 · reserve months 5.1
Tax year 2016 — took in $253,327 more than it spent. Revenue $888,486 · expenses $635,159 · reserve months 10.2
Tax year 2015 — took in $104,589 more than it spent. Revenue $566,305 · expenses $461,716 · reserve months 2.9
